When shopping for an SUV, visibility is a crucial factor that impacts safety, comfort, and driving confidence. Many modern SUVs prioritize style over functionality, incorporating sleek designs that compromise window size and sightlines.

However, the best SUVs for visibility balance aesthetics with practicality, offering large windows, slim roof pillars, and elevated seating positions.

Additionally, advanced technology, including night vision systems, surround-view cameras, and adaptive headlights, further enhances visibility. This article explores some of the top SUVs with the best visibility, analyzing their design, features, and technology that make them stand out in this crucial category.

1. 2019 Subaru Forester: Clear Vision with Advanced Safety

The 2019 Subaru Forester exemplifies an SUV engineered for superior visibility. With Subaru’s Eyesight safety package, drivers benefit from advanced driver-assistance features, including adaptive cruise control and lane departure warning.

Additionally, the Forester’s design enhances traditional visibility, featuring thin front roof pillars and well-placed front quarter windows for an expansive field of view.

The SUV also boasts 8.7 inches of ground clearance, elevating the driver’s position for improved sight over traffic. LED headlights, standard across all models, ensure optimal illumination at night, further contributing to this vehicle’s reputation for exceptional visibility and driver awareness.

2. 2019 Land Rover Range Rover: Luxury Meets Visibility

Luxury and visibility converge in the 2019 Land Rover Range Rover, a vehicle designed with a tall, upright silhouette and expansive windows. The large greenhouse provides a panoramic view, reducing blind spots and enhancing driver confidence.

Technological advancements bolster its visibility, with a 360-degree surround-view camera system, blind-spot monitoring, and lane-keeping assistance.

The Range Rover’s adjustable air suspension is another unique feature, allowing the vehicle to raise its ground clearance to 11.6 inches. This added height improves forward visibility, making the Range Rover a top contender for those seeking a premium SUV with outstanding sightlines.

3. 2019 Honda Pilot: Family-Friendly Visibility

For those seeking a three-row SUV with excellent visibility, the 2019 Honda Pilot is a strong choice. Its spacious design ensures clear sightlines for drivers and passengers alike.

Although its 7.3 inches of ground clearance is lower than that of some competitors, the Pilot compensates with Honda Sensing, a suite of safety features including collision mitigation braking and adaptive cruise control.

A standard multi-view backup camera enhances rearward visibility, making parking and reversing easier. With its combination of well-placed windows, driver-assist technology, and a family-friendly layout, the Honda Pilot offers a practical solution for visibility-conscious buyers.

4. 2019 Cadillac Escalade: High-Tech Visibility Enhancements

The 2019 Cadillac Escalade introduces a unique visibility advantage with its rear camera mirror system. This feature expands the driver’s rearward view by four times compared to a traditional mirror.

At the push of a button, the mirror transforms into a high-definition video screen displaying a live feed from a rear-mounted camera. This eliminates obstructions caused by passengers or cargo.

The Escalade also incorporates a suite of radar- and camera-based systems, ensuring a comprehensive visibility experience. Combined with its tall greenhouse and advanced driver assistance features, the Escalade remains a top pick for visibility-focused luxury SUV buyers.

5. 2019 Jeep Wrangler: Ultimate Open-Air Visibility

Unlike any other SUV, the 2019 Jeep Wrangler offers unparalleled visibility by allowing drivers to remove the top and doors and fold down the windshield.

These unique features provide an almost 360-degree unobstructed view, making the Wrangler ideal for off-road enthusiasts and adventure seekers. Additionally, Jeep improved the rear visibility of this model by repositioning the spare tire and rear windshield wiper.

While some SUVs rely on cameras and sensors for visibility, the Wrangler’s open-air design gives drivers a direct, unfiltered view of their surroundings, reinforcing its status as a top choice for visibility.

6. 2018 Mercedes-Benz G550 4X4: Towering Visibility

For those seeking both off-road capability and superior visibility, the 2018 Mercedes-Benz G550 4X4 delivers. Its boxy design includes large windows and thin roof pillars for excellent outward visibility.

Sitting at an impressive 17.2 inches of ground clearance, the G550 provides an elevated driving position unmatched by most SUVs. While its high price point limits accessibility, the G550 includes Mercedes’ luxury features and driver-assistance technologies, ensuring a high-end visibility experience.

Though its off-road capabilities are unparalleled, it remains a practical choice for those who prioritize visibility in an ultra-premium package.

7. 2018 Audi Q7: German Engineering for Visibility

The 2018 Audi Q7 demonstrates how strategic engineering can enhance visibility. Designed with a low-profile dashboard, the Q7 minimizes obstructions in the driver’s forward view.

The large windows and thin roof pillars contribute to improved outward visibility. A standout feature is Audi’s night vision assistant, which uses infrared sensors to detect pedestrians and large animals in low-light conditions.

This military-grade technology provides an extra layer of security, helping drivers see beyond their headlights’ reach. With a blend of traditional visibility enhancements and cutting-edge tech, the Audi Q7 remains a top option for safety-conscious buyers.

8. 2019 Volvo XC90: Tech-Focused Visibility Solutions

The 2019 Volvo XC90 combines practical design with advanced technology to optimize visibility. Its relatively slim roof pillars and expansive windshield provide a clear view of the road ahead.

With 9.4 inches of ground clearance, the XC90 offers a high seating position for an improved driving perspective. Additionally, the SUV’s multimode air suspension can increase height by 1.6 inches when needed.

Volvo’s collision-mitigation system further enhances safety by detecting vehicles, pedestrians, and cyclists, automatically applying brakes if necessary. This blend of physical and technological visibility solutions makes the XC90 a well-rounded option for discerning buyers.

9. 2018 Kia Soul: Affordable Visibility Champion

For budget-conscious shoppers, the 2018 Kia Soul delivers outstanding visibility at an affordable price. Its boxy design and upright stance create large windows and minimal blind spots.

The Soul also received top ratings from the IIHS for its high-intensity discharge headlamps, ensuring clear nighttime visibility. In terms of safety technology, Kia includes features like a blind-spot monitor, rear cross-traffic alert, and forward-collision warning with automatic emergency braking.

Despite its smaller size and lower ground clearance, the Soul’s superior visibility features and affordability make it an excellent choice for city drivers and commuters.

10. 2018 Nissan Armada: High-Tech Visibility Features

The 2018 Nissan Armada excels in visibility with its blend of design and technology. Its Intelligent Forward Collision Warning system monitors two vehicles ahead, giving drivers advanced alerts.

An intelligent rearview mirror displays a live video feed from a rear-mounted camera, eliminating obstructions inside the cabin. This allows for a consistently clear rearward view, regardless of passenger or cargo placement.
